Track Your Absentee Ballot; Military … WebOct 31, 2024 · According to Iowa Code §53.23, early voting results are released on Election Day, but not any earlier. An election commissioner generally convenes the special precinct board to begin counting absentee ballots on the day of the election. However, the commissioner is able to convene the board as early as the day before the election.

WebOct 31, 2024 · The state offers 20 days of early voting, which includes both in-person and mail-in voting. Iowans can cast their ballots early in person at their county auditor's office or, in some cases, at a satellite voting location. The final day of in-person early voting is the day before Election Day. Republican majorities in the Iowa Legislature ...
